Toxic Strawberries

ListenDownloadopen in itunesHQ Audio Download

11.04.19 - 12:00pm

By Antonio Ortiz

We expect to find strawberries in the supermarket all year round.  But geographer Julie Guthman argues that for strawberries to be produced throughout the year — which used to be harvested a few weeks in spring — has required an enormous marshaling of chemical fumigants, pesticides, workers’ labor, and land.  And that effort is now … Continued

Capitalism and Food Regimes

ListenDownloadopen in itunesHQ Audio Download

10.29.19 - 12:00pm

By Antonio Ortiz

If we look back over the 20th century and even into the 19th, we can see a series of historical periods that shaped how food was produced and consumed. And we can see how periods of relative stability alternated with periods of crisis. Sociologist Harriet Friedmann discusses her theory of food regimes and what they … Continued

Reconsidering Yugoslav Socialism

ListenDownloadopen in itunesHQ Audio Download

03.25.19 - 12:00pm

By siteadmin

Socialist Yugoslavia was born out of resistance to fascist occupation during WW2 and ended in dismemberment and civil war.  Today, Yugoslavia’s demise is much better remembered than what came before it.  Yet socialist Yugoslavia forged a different path from that of the Soviet Union, which broke with it, and experimented with a form of workers’ … Continued

Wobblies of the World

ListenDownloadopen in itunesHQ Audio Download

05.01.18 - 12:00pm

By siteadmin

By way of celebrating International Workers Day, or May Day, we look back at the legendary union, the Industrial Workers of the World, or Wobblies, with historian Kenyon Zimmer.  He discusses the lessons to be learned from how the Wobblies fought back and united workers across cultural and racial differences.
